WebDec 2, 2024 · Nous (adj. noetic) in Orthodox Christianity is the eye of the soul.Just as the soul of man, is created by God, man's soul is intelligent and noetic. St. Thalassios wrote that God created beings "with a capacity to receive the Spirit and to attain knowledge of Himself; He has brought into existence the senses and sensory perception to serve such beings." WebJun 20, 2024 · 6. The Orthodox Church highly values the Church Fathers. There is a strong sense in which the Orthodox Church sees themselves as the living continuation of the ideas of the Church Fathers, like St. John Chrysostom, Basil the Great, and Gregory of Nazianzus, known as “the three holy hierarchs.”.
